Certification: This role is subject to certification. Certification applies to key roles within the organization that meet set criteria defined by our regulators. Certification is an internal process undertaken in line with regulatory requirements that is to be in place on appointment and annually thereafter.
Certified Function: This role is subject to certification for MSIL due to being identified as a Manager of Certified Employees. This role is responsible for the management of certified employees, and as such is held to the same standard of accountability.
